The Hermitage & Cold Ash area is located in West Berkshire, near the town of Newbury. It consists of two villages, Hermitage to the west and Cold Ash to the east, both surrounded by rural landscapes. The area is known for its mix of residential properties, local amenities, and green spaces, including parts of the North Wessex Downs AONB. The A34 runs nearby, providing connections to Oxford and Southampton.
Cold Ash is home to several schools, including St. Finian's Catholic Primary and The Downs School, making it a popular choice for families. Hermitage has a smaller village feel with a community shop and sports facilities. The area offers walking routes through woodlands and farmland, such as Ashmore Green and Bucklebury Common. Public transport links include local bus services to Newbury and Reading.
On average Hermitage & Cold Ash has very low de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 28 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 8.2%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income of residents in Hermitage & Cold Ash is £70,300 per year. There are 7 schools in Hermitage & Cold Ash: 6 primary (0 Outstanding and 6 Good) and 0 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good).
Based on 64 recent sales, the median property price is £564,500 in Hermitage & Cold Ash area, with individual transactions ranging from £238,000 up to £1,850,000.
Type | Sales | Median |
---|---|---|
Detached | 40 | £748,750 |
Semi-Detached | 19 | £386,500 |
Terraced | 5 | £335,000 |
